Country Overview: Power & Infrastructure
United Arab Emirates
The UAE, with a population of 10 million and a GDP of USD 547 billion, is the Middle East’s most diversified economy. Despite near-universal grid access, diesel generators remain essential in three sectors: (1) Mega-construction — projects like the Burj Khalifa expansion, Expo City Dubai Phase 2, and Abu Dhabi’s Saadiyat Island Cultural District rely on temporary generator farms for construction power, (2) Oil & Gas — ADNOC offshore platforms and onshore rigs, and (3) Events — Dubai hosts over 400 exhibitions annually requiring temporary power.
Philippines
The Philippines, an archipelago of 7,641 islands with a population of 116 million, faces extreme power infrastructure challenges. Approximately 2.5 million households lack grid access, and the national grid (NGCP) is vulnerable to typhoons, earthquakes, and volcanic activity. The Small Island Grid (SIG) program under the Department of Energy deploys thousands of diesel generators to power off-grid islands. Additionally, the BPO (business process outsourcing) sector in Metro Manila and Cebu requires reliable backup power for 24/7 call center operations.

Case Study 2: Small Island Microgrid Generator Fleet — Palawan, Philippines
Customer Profile
A government-contracted power utility operating 42 diesel-power microgrids across the Calamian Islands of Palawan Province (Busuanga, Coron, Culion). The microgrids serve approximately 35,000 residents and tourism infrastructure (Coron is a major ecotourism destination). The generator fleet includes: 24 Volvo Penta TAD1642GE (600 kVA), 12 Cummins QSM11-G5 (275 kVA), and 6 Yanmar 6EY22ALW (650 kVA) units, operating 18–24 hours/day depending on island.
Challenge
Palawan’s islands are accessible only by ferry (8–12 hours from Manila) or small aircraft. This creates extreme logistics challenges for generator parts: a simple fuel filter replacement takes 3–4 weeks if ordered through the Manila dealer network, and shipping costs via inter-island freight are 2–3× the part cost. During the 2025 typhoon season (June–November), the utility experienced generator failures on 5 islands simultaneously after Typhoon Carina, with fuel contamination and salt-spray corrosion being primary issues. The utility needed a reliable parts supplier that could provide consolidated quarterly shipments with corrosion-resistant packaging.

All parts shipped in VCI (Volatile Corrosion Inhibitor) packaging with desiccant to prevent salt-spray corrosion during inter-island transit.
